    We are deeply saddened to report on the passing of Mrs. Mala Wichin, a widely respected and admired educator has passed away at the age of 78.

    Mrs. Wichnin was born in Poland in 1945, just after the end of World War II, to her parents Yoel and Zelda Zebrowitz o.b.m.

    Her parents were eventually able to bring the family to America where they invested extreme Mesiras Nefesh to raise their children in a frum home and provide them with a solid Torah Jewish education.

    From the time she was a child, Mrs. Wichnin was always a diligent and exemplary student, acquiring a vast knowledge of Torah and all related subjects.

    She used her knowledge and extremely caring character to enter the world of Chinuch in 1960. She served as a teacher in a variety of capacities for ~over~ sixty years and inspired thousands of students from all walks of life.

    Mrs. Wichnin first taught in Beis Yaakov of Boro Park and then in Beis Rivkah and many other schools.

    On the 14th of Kislev, 5723 (1962) she married the legendary Rosh Yeshiva Rabbi Dovid Wichnin o.b.m. After living in NY for ten years they moved to Boston where they lived for 8 Years. Rabbi Wichin was hired in 5738 to serve as the lead Rosh Yeshiva in Tiferes Bachurim in Morristown and the Wichnin’s moved to Monsey, New York, where Mrs. Wichnin taught in the Beis Yaakov of Monsey for 40 years.

    A few weeks ago, Mrs. Wichnin moved to Yerushalayim to live near her son Reb Yisroel Noach שי’ . She passed away this morning, the 17th of Cheshvan, 5784,  at the age of 78.

    She was a unique model of modesty and lived an ascetic life, which was an extreme inspiration to all that knew her. (In respect of that modesty, pictures do not accompany this notice.)

    She is survived by her children Faigy Wichnin (New York), Rabbi Yisroel Noach (Yerushalayim) and Rabbi Nachman Dov (Crown Heights).

    She is also survived by her sister Mrs. Shoshana Minkowicz (Crown Heights)
